Insomnia in the Context of Cancer: A Review of a Neglected
Problem
ABSTRACT: This article reviews the evidence on the diagnosis,
epidemiology, etiology, and treatment of insomnia in the context
of cancer and proposes several areas for future research. Clinical
and diagnostic features of insomnia are described and prevalence
estimates of insomnia complaints in cancer patients are summarized.
Then, potential etiologic factors (ie, predisposing, precipitating,
and perpetuating factors) and consequences of insomnia (ie, psychologic,
behavioral, and health impact) in the context of cancer are discussed.
Finally, pharmacologic and psychologic treatments previously
shown effective to treat insomnia in healthy individuals are
discussed as valuable treatment options for cancer patients as
well. Because long-term use of hypnotic medications is associated
with some risks (eg, dependence), it is argued that psychologic
interventions (eg, stimulus control, sleep restriction, cognitive
therapy) are the treatment of choice for sleep disturbances in
the context of cancer, especially when it has reached a chronic
course. However, the efficacy of these treatments has yet to
be verified specifically in cancer patients.
02/07/2001; Journal of Clinical Oncology
